T-shirt sizing is a popular Agile estimation method used to gauge the relative size of work items like user stories. It involves assigning sizes such as small, medium, or large to tasks, providing a rough estimate of the work required. The method is less precise than others but is quick and effective for backlog management. T-shirt sizing can be interpreted using Fibonacci numbers, exponential scales, or by estimating the number of iterations needed. The process involves team discussions to reach consensus, and it is valued for its simplicity, effectiveness, and fun approach.
